The highly anticipated Sonic Racing: CrossWorlds is currently available on the Nintendo Switch, though its performance has left some players wanting more. This has naturally fueled excitement for a potential release on the rumored Switch 2 console. In a recent discussion, series producer Takashi Iizuka shed light on the reasoning behind the delayed launch for the next-generation hardware.

Iizuka confirmed that the development team originally aimed for a simultaneous multi-platform release. However, the Switch 2’s reported launch date of June 5, 2025 created a scheduling conflict. The extra time is essential for the developers to properly refine and enhance the game, ensuring it fully leverages the new console’s capabilities. Iizuka emphasized that the priority is to deliver a product that is specifically optimized for the advanced hardware, rather than rushing out a port.

A key focus for the team is maintaining content parity across all platforms, including the original Switch. This principle is fundamental to the game’s cross-play functionality. Iizuka stressed the importance of providing a consistent and high-quality experience for every racer, regardless of the system they choose to play on. While specific technical details for the Switch 2 version remain under wraps, the community is hopeful for buttery-smooth 60fps gameplay. The potential for 4K resolution is still unconfirmed, leaving fans eager for future announcements that will reveal how the game performs on Nintendo’s next console.
